Hillesden House in Leek, Staffordshire is an enhanced 24/7 supported living service for people living with a mental health diagnosis, mild learning disability brain injury or autism.
Hillesden House is located in a residential area close to the centre of Leek. The service will have 18 ensuite rooms and communal areas including a fully equipped kitchen and garden.
As with all of our residential mental health support services, our residents benefit from ‘The Northern Healthcare model of enhanced supported living’, with 24/7 support onsite and clinical input from a Registered Mental Health Nurse and Occupational Therapist.
The team provide 24/7 support for people with a variety of mental health conditions. Our residents come to us from a number of different pathways; they may need greater ‘step down’ support following a period in an acute hospital or forensic service. Our experienced multi-disciplinary team help our residents to achieve their next steps, from simple tasks such as dieting and budgeting to longer-term goals such as gaining employment.
